JOB PURPOSE
To support in the acquisition, analysis and interpretation of geological data to identify and evaluate potential oil and gas deposits.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ES
- Assist in the analysis and interpretation of geological and geophysical data, including seismic data and well logs, to identify subsurface structures for reservoir modeling and resources assessment.
- Participate in the collection, quality control, storage and analysis of geological data and physical field and well samples.
- Participate in geological and geophysical field mapping.
- Participate in monitoring the acquisition of geological and geophysical data to ensure quality.
- Assemble, operate, and maintain field and laboratory equipment, working as part of a crew when required.
- Collect and prepare information, solid and fluid samples for analysis; and Conduct analyses on samples to determine their content and characteristics.
- Prepare notes, sketches, cross sections, reports and maps that can be used to define geological characteristics of prospective areas.
- Plot information from aerial photographs, well logs, section descriptions, and other databases.
- Support development of operational procedures for exploration operations
- Work closely with geologists, geophysicists and other team members to integrate geophysical data and interpretations for exploration projects.
- Acquire knowledge in geological and geophysical methods and techniques used in the oil and gas industry.
- Learn to use geological data interpretation software and tools, staying updated on industry advancements in geophysical techniques.
- Promote a culture of health, safety, and environmental responsibility within the geophysics team.
- Provide regular updates and reports to the Exploration Geologist and team members on geophysical findings, progress, and recommendations.
- Undertake any other duties and responsibilities as may be assigned from time to time by the supervisor(s).
Qualifications & Experience
- Bachelor of Science (Bsc Hons) in either Geology and Chemistry, Physics and Mathematics, Petroleum Geosciences & Petroleum Engineering, or other relevant honours degree from a recognised University.
- Zero to three (0-3) years of working experience in Petroleum E&P Operations.
- Membership in the relevant oil and gas industry professional bodies like SPE, AAPG, and SEG is an added advantage.
Skills & Competencies
- Strong analytical skills and attention to detail for accurate interpretation of geophysical data.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to collaborate effectively with team members.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to collaborate effectively with team members.
- Willingness to learn and adapt new geophysical techniques and technologies.
- Ability to work both independently and within a multidisciplinary team environment.
- Knowledge of Health, Safety and Environment practices in Oil and Gas.
